Clip-In Extensions: Effortless Style in Minutes

Clip-In Extensions

Clip-in extensions are particularly popular and user-friendly, especially for those trying extensions for the first time. They are sold in sections with attached small clips, making it easy to secure them to your natural hair quickly.

These extensions are ideal for temporary changes, allowing you to apply them before an event and remove them at your convenience without needing a salon visit.

Key benefits include:

  • Simple to apply and remove
  • No harm to natural hair
  • Cost-effective compared to permanent alternatives
  • Excellent for infrequent use

They are perfect for those who enjoy frequently altering their appearance, offering flexibility without obligating you to long-term upkeep.

Tape-In Extensions: An Effortless Everyday Choice

Tape-In Extensions

Tape-in extensions are crafted for a more natural, long-lasting look. They consist of thin strips of hair that adhere near the scalp with a strong adhesive tape, resulting in a seamless and flat finish.

Remy Tape Hair Extensions, a favored variety, are celebrated for their smoothness and natural strand alignment, minimizing tangling and maintaining an elegant appearance over time.

Reasons for their popularity include:

  • Lightweight and comfortable to wear
  • Blend seamlessly with your natural hair
  • Suitable for everyday use
  • Last several weeks with appropriate care

While professional installation and maintenance are necessary, the outcome is a polished, native appearance ideal for day-to-day styling.

Sew-In Extensions: Durable and Reliable

Sew-in extensions, also referred to as weaves, are secured by braiding your natural hair and sewing the extensions into these braids, making them well-known for their durability and secure hold.

These extensions are best suited for thicker hair and those seeking a more long-lasting solution.

Key advantages include:

  • Extremely secure and enduring
  • Excellent for increasing volume
  • Minimal daily styling required

However, they must be professionally applied and cared for to prevent stress on the scalp. When done properly, they can last for weeks maintaining a consistent appearance.

Fusion and Pre-Bonded Extensions Uncovered

Fusion extensions use a keratin bond that is melted and attached to your natural hair, providing a very natural-looking result due to the small, discreet bonds.

These extensions are:

  • Long-lasting, often between 3 to 4 months
  • Customizable in terms of volume and length
  • Seamlessly integrated with natural hair

The downside includes the time and cost associated; installation can take hours, and removal needs to be done with care to avoid damage. Still, for those seeking a long-term change, fusion extensions are an option worth exploring.

Deciding Between Synthetic and Human Hair Extensions

When purchasing extensions, you’ll need to choose between synthetic and human hair options.

Human hair extensions:

  • Offer a more natural appearance
  • Can be styled with heat
  • Tend to have greater longevity with proper upkeep

Synthetic extensions:

  • More budget-friendly
  • Come pre-styled and require less maintenance
  • Have limited styling capabilities

For those desiring a natural look and styling flexibility, human hair is typically the preferable option as it integrates better with your hair.

FAQ: Clarifying Hair Extensions

Q1: Are hair extensions safe for my natural hair?

Yes, extensions are safe when applied and cared for properly. It’s crucial to choose the right type and to avoid excessive tension.

Q2: What is the lifespan of hair extensions?

The longevity varies with the type; clip-ins can last for years with proper care, whereas tape-ins and fusion extensions typically last for weeks to months.

Q3: Is it permissible to style extensions with heat?

Yes, but only if they are human hair. Always use heat protectant products to ensure the safety of the extensions.

Q4: How can I select the best color?

Match extensions to the mid-lengths and ends of your hair rather than the roots for a seamless blend.

Q5: Are professional installations necessary for extensions?

Some types, such as tape-ins and sew-ins, require professional installation, while clip-ins and ponytail extensions can be self-applied at home.
